Today's release v0.0.3-alpha.35 includes: ➡️ Ventura-style Settings ➡️ improved file inspector ➡️ debug area navigation ➡️ terminal tabs ➡️ bracket pair highlighting ➡️ beginnings of an extension API Note: Our bundle ID changed so you may see a warning that indicates this.

Alpha Release 0.0.3 (37) is here! 🎉🚀 It's been a while since we've last released, so we have a lot for you in this one. Some things include... ✨ Updated product icon ✨ New faster source editor and text view ✨ Source control navigator ✨ Project indexing ✨ Faster project search ✨ Real-time cursor location in status bar ✨ Path bar picker design update ✨ Focus single editor ✨ Unsaved file indicator ✨ Settings search 🐞 Numerous fixes to overall app stability It is still in alpha so we know it isn't perfect however we'd love to hear your feedback! 📣 github.com/CodeEditApp/CodeE… #buildinpublic #oss #developertools #macOS

In the next version of CodeEdit Our terminal pane gets some upgrades: - Terminal state is now kept when tabbing away from terminals. - A longstanding font rendering bug has been fixed. - Clearing the terminal is now more consistent with other terminal emulators.

In the next version of CodeEdit Running tasks! Basic support for defining and running tasks in a shell. Tasks identify if they've failed or succeeded based on the exit code, and are defined in a JSON file. Big ups to @activecoding for getting this started!

In the next version of CodeEdit Our source editor now has support for commenting multiple lines with ⌘/. This feature is language dependent, so HTML comments will appear differently from Swift, Javascript, etc depending on the detected language.
